Searched refs:Registers (Results 1 - 8 of 8) sorted by relevance

/freebsd-10.2-release/contrib/llvm/utils/TableGen/
H A DCodeGenRegisters.cpp946 Registers.reserve(Regs.size());
968 for (unsigned i = 0, e = Registers.size(); i != e; ++i)
969 Registers[i]->buildObjectGraph(*this);
972 for (unsigned i = 0, e = Registers.size(); i != e; ++i)
974 Registers[i]->TheDef->getValueAsString("AsmName"),
975 Registers[i]);
979 for (unsigned i = 0, e = Registers.size(); i != e; ++i)
980 Registers[i]->computeSubRegs(*this);
983 for (unsigned i = 0, e = Registers.size(); i != e; ++i)
984 if (Registers[
1251 const std::vector<CodeGenRegister*> &Registers = RegBank.getRegisters(); local
[all...]
H A DAsmWriterEmitter.cpp523 const std::vector<CodeGenRegister*> &Registers) {
525 SmallVector<std::string, 4> AsmNames(Registers.size());
526 for (unsigned i = 0, e = Registers.size(); i != e; ++i) {
527 const CodeGenRegister &Reg = *Registers[i];
566 for (unsigned i = 0, e = Registers.size(); i != e; ++i) {
578 const std::vector<CodeGenRegister*> &Registers =
592 O << " assert(RegNo && RegNo < " << (Registers.size()+1)
598 emitRegisterNameString(O, AltNameIndices[i]->getName(), Registers);
600 emitRegisterNameString(O, "", Registers);
H A DRegisterInfoEmitter.cpp71 const std::vector<CodeGenRegister*> &Registers = Bank.getRegisters(); local
74 assert(Registers.size() <= 0xffff && "Too many regs to fit in tables");
76 std::string Namespace = Registers[0]->TheDef->getValueAsString("Namespace");
93 for (unsigned i = 0, e = Registers.size(); i != e; ++i)
94 OS << " " << Registers[i]->getName() << " = " <<
95 Registers[i]->EnumValue << ",\n";
96 assert(Registers.size() == Registers[Registers.size()-1]->EnumValue &&
98 OS << " NUM_TARGET_REGS \t// " << Registers
[all...]
H A DCodeGenRegisters.h172 // less than RegBank.getNumTopoSigs(). Registers with the same TopoSig have
461 // Registers.
462 std::vector<CodeGenRegister*> Registers; member in class:llvm::CodeGenRegBank
552 const std::vector<CodeGenRegister*> &getRegisters() { return Registers; }
560 // Get a Register's index into the Registers array.
H A DAsmMatcherEmitter.cpp196 RegisterSet Registers; member in struct:__anon3846::ClassInfo
218 // Registers classes are only related to registers classes, and only if
226 std::set_intersection(Registers.begin(), Registers.end(),
227 RHS.Registers.begin(), RHS.Registers.end(),
1082 const std::vector<CodeGenRegister*> &Registers = local
1109 for (std::vector<CodeGenRegister*>::const_iterator it = Registers.begin(),
1110 ie = Registers.end(); it != ie; ++it) {
1151 CI->Registers
[all...]
/freebsd-10.2-release/contrib/llvm/lib/Target/ARM/AsmParser/
H A DARMAsmParser.cpp336 SmallVector<unsigned, 8> Registers; member in class:__anon2479::ARMOperand
489 Registers = o.Registers;
575 return Registers;
2374 Op->Registers.push_back(I->second);
3056 SmallVector<std::pair<unsigned, unsigned>, 16> Registers; local
3062 Registers.push_back(std::pair<unsigned, unsigned>(EReg, Reg));
3077 Registers.push_back(std::pair<unsigned, unsigned>(EReg, Reg));
3108 Registers.push_back(std::pair<unsigned, unsigned>(EReg, Reg));
3145 Registers
[all...]
/freebsd-10.2-release/crypto/openssl/crypto/bn/asm/
H A Dpa-risc2.s918 ; Registers to hold 64-bit values to manipulate. The "L" part
H A Dpa-risc2W.s905 ; Registers to hold 64-bit values to manipulate. The "L" part

Completed in 98 milliseconds